Delhi, the capital city of India, is a vibrant and bustling metropolis that is steeped in history and culture. From ancient monuments to bustling markets, Delhi is a treasure trove of hidden gems waiting to be discovered. In this blog post, we will take you on a virtual tour of some of the must-visit places in Delhi, giving you a taste of the rich cultural heritage and unique experiences that the city has to offer. One of the first hidden gems that you must explore in Delhi is the Qutub Minar. This towering minaret is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and is one of the most iconic landmarks in the city. Built in the 12th century, the Qutub Minar stands at a height of 73 meters and is surrounded by beautiful gardens and ancient ruins. This trendy neighborhood is a hub for art, culture, and fashion. With its narrow lanes, quirky cafes, and art galleries, Hauz Khas Village offers a unique blend of old-world charm and contemporary vibes. Take a leisurely stroll through the village, explore the boutiques and art studios, and indulge in some delicious food at the local cafes. If you are a food lover, then a visit to Chandni Chowk is a must. This bustling market in Old Delhi is famous for its street food and traditional Indian sweets. From mouth-watering chaat to delectable parathas, Chandni Chowk offers a culinary experience like no other. Don't forget to try the famous jalebis and rabri at the iconic sweet shops in the area. For history enthusiasts, a visit to the Red Fort is a must. This magnificent fort, built by the Mughal emperor Shah Jahan,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and is a testament to the grandeur of Mughal architecture. Explore the sprawling complex, visit the museums, and witness the sound and light show that brings the history of the fort to life. Delhi is also home to several beautiful temples that are worth a visit. The Lotus Temple, with its stunning architecture and serene atmosphere, is a must-visit for those seeking peace and tranquility. The Akshardham Temple, on the other hand, is a marvel of modern architecture and offers a unique spiritual experience.
